First off, let's understand what track curvature maintenance is all about. Tracks aren't always straight; they have curves, and these curves need to be in tip - top shape for trains to run smoothly and safely. Curved tracks experience different kinds of wear and tear compared to straight ones. The outer rail on a curve bears more pressure from the train's centrifugal force, while the inner rail has its own unique set of challenges.
So, where do train rail grinders come into play? Well, these machines are like the superheroes of the railway maintenance world. They help in a bunch of ways when it comes to maintaining the curvature of the tracks.
One of the main impacts is on reducing uneven wear. Over time, the constant friction between the train wheels and the curved tracks causes uneven wear patterns. The outer rail on a curve can wear down faster on the gauge face, and the inner rail might have issues with the running surface. A train rail grinder can precisely target these areas and remove the unevenly worn material. By doing so, it restores the proper profile of the rail, which is crucial for maintaining the correct curvature. For example, if the gauge face of the outer rail is worn too much, it can lead to the train wheels not sitting properly, which might cause derailment risks. Another important aspect is improving the contact between the train wheels and the tracks. On curved tracks, the contact between the wheels and the rails is more complex than on straight tracks. Uneven wear can disrupt this contact, leading to increased noise, vibration, and even higher energy consumption for the trains. A well - maintained rail profile, achieved through grinding, allows for a better and more consistent contact between the wheels and the rails. This not only makes the ride smoother for passengers but also reduces the stress on the train components and the tracks themselves. Train rail grinders also play a role in preventing cracks and defects. Curved tracks are more prone to developing cracks due to the additional stress they experience. Grinding the rails regularly can help remove the surface defects that might lead to cracks. For instance, small surface flaws can act as stress concentrators, and over time, these can grow into larger cracks that compromise the integrity of the track. By preventing cracks, the grinder helps in maintaining the long - term integrity of the track curvature. If a crack develops on a curved track, it can cause the rail to deform, which will directly affect the curvature and pose a serious safety risk.
In addition to the technical benefits, using train rail grinders for track curvature maintenance can also have economic advantages. By reducing the wear and tear on the tracks, the lifespan of the rails is extended. This means that railway operators don't have to replace the rails as frequently, which saves a ton of money in the long run. Also, the improved ride quality and reduced energy consumption of the trains can result in cost savings for the operators. And let's not forget about the safety aspect. A well - maintained track curvature reduces the risk of accidents, which can have huge financial and human costs.
